What Is Total Distance?
Total distance refers to the overall length of a route or journey, measured continuously from the starting point to the endpoint—regardless of direction or backtracking. Unlike total route length, which may account for repeats or detours, total distance represents the true physical length traversed.
For example:
- A round trip of 150 miles (75 miles out, 75 miles back) has a total distance of 150 miles.
- If a route loops back multiple times, the accumulated total distance increases (e.g., three iterations of a 100-mile loop total 300 miles).

Why Total Distance Matters
For Travelers
Knowing the total distance helps estimate fuel costs, travel time, and delivery schedules. It forms the basis for route planning apps and mapping tools, ensuring you arrive on time and avoid unexpected delays.
For Fitness Enthusiasts
Tracking total distance walked, run, or cycled enables accurate progress measurement. It helps athletes benchmark performance, set challenging milestones, and stay motivated by visualizing cumulative effort.

For Logistics and Delivery Services
Total distance directly impacts operational efficiency. It determines vehicle routing, fuel consumption, delivery windows, and employee compensation. Efficiently managing total distance optimizes routes and cuts costs.
How to Calculate Total Distance
Calculating total distance depends on your data source and precision needs. Here are the most common methods:
1. Using GPS and Mapping Apps
Modern navigation apps (like Waze, Apple Maps, or GPS devices) automatically track and sum total distance driven or walked in real time.
2. Manual Averaging
If traveling with stops or using a smartphone sensor, compute total distance by summing individual segment distances recorded over a journey.
3. Logistics Software
Fleet management platforms integrate GPS data with route analytics to measure total miles or kilometers traveled per delivery, vehicle, or driver.
Formula Example:
Total Distance = Outbound Distance + Return Distance
For multi-stop journeys:
Total Distance = Sum of distances between all consecutive waypoints along the route
